Gitea Actions Runner — Hostinger VM rollout
This folder contains everything needed to set up the canonical CI/CD pipeline for @bytelyst/* package publishing: a self-hosted act_runner on the Hostinger Gitea, paired with a matching runner on the corp Mac local Gitea.

Why this lives in its own folder
docs/devops/ is filling up with multi-doc workstreams (Azure setup, KV rotation, single-VM deployment, E2EE, etc.). To prevent future roadmaps and delegation prompts from colliding with each other, each multi-doc workstream gets its own subfolder. Pattern to follow when you start a similar workstream:
docs/devops/<workstream-slug>/
README.md # this file — index
CODEX_DELEGATION_PROMPT.md # paste-to-codex bootstrap
ROADMAP.md # phased checklist with checkboxes + commit hashes
<DETAIL_DOC_1>.md # implementation detail
<DETAIL_DOC_2>.md
_PLAN_B_<alternative>.md # discarded alternatives (underscore prefix = deprioritized)
Architecture summary (1-paragraph)
The same v* git tag pushed to two Gitea instances (corp Mac local + Hostinger) triggers each Gitea's own act_runner to build @bytelyst/* packages inside the same pinned Docker image (node:20-bookworm@sha256:...) from the same lockfile. Deterministic builds → byte-identical tarballs → matching SHA512 integrity → lockfiles portable across both registries. No sync script. No GitHub Organization migration. No third-party billing entanglements. See ROADMAP.md §🎯 Outcome for the invariant.
